Psalms 89:36

"Once I have sworn by my holiness, I will not lie to David."

Key Reflection

In the context of ancient Near Eastern culture, where treaties and oaths were taken very seriously, this verse conveys God's unshakeable commitment to His covenant with David. By swearing by His own holiness, God emphasizes that He is not merely making a casual promise but one grounded in His very nature as a holy and faithful deity, ensuring that the dynasty of King David will be secure and enduring.
